by Phil Glover (Author)

This book explores the law relating to interception, investigatory powers, data retention and surveillance with primary reference to the UK, while also embracing the USA and EU. It reconceptualizes the relationship between data collection and data analysis.

Author Biography

Phil Glover was born and raised near Belfast, Northern Ireland. Having left school without qualifications, he served in the Royal Ulster Constabulary between 1983 and 2002. He returned to higher education in Scotland in 2008 and obtained an LLB (Honours) from the University of Aberdeen in 2012. He completed a PhD at the University of Aberdeen in 2015 before commencing a career in academia. He now teaches criminal law and conducts comparative national security-related research at Curtin University Law School, Perth, Western Australia.
